Rivers Police, Civil Defence, bare teeth at Salah holidays, but hot spots in Garden City still dreaded

Both the Nigerian Police Command and the Civil Defence bared their teeth as the Salah holidays came close, followed by a weekend, giving Nigerians almost a one-week holiday. Hot spots in the Garden City, especially Eleme Junction and Oil Mill Market, remain dreaded.

The police in the state is led by Olugbenga Adepoju, while the Nigerian Security and Civil Defence Corps (NSCDC) is led by Joachim Okafor. They said they rolled out strategic and technical resources to promote peace in the state for people to enjoy a long rest.

The Rivers State Police Command, under Adepoju, said it intensified security operations and deployed robust safety measures across the State even ahead of the Eid-el-Kabir and Children’s Day celebrations.

According to Agabe Blessing Kaborlo, an assistant superintendent of police (ASP), who is the Police Public Relations Officer (PPRO) of the State Police command, the strategic security initiative was aimed at guaranteeing a peaceful, crime-free, and hitch-free festive period for all residents and visitors across Rivers State.

In line with this commitment, she stated, the Command activated comprehensive operational strategies including intensified confidence-building patrols, intelligence-led policing, strategic deployment of tactical and conventional personnel, surveillance operations, stop-and-search duties, and enhanced visibility policing in critical locations and other vulnerable areas across the State.

Security presence has also been reinforced around worship centres, recreational facilities, markets, motor parks, highways, and other public spaces expected to witness increased human and vehicular movement during the celebrations.
